Objectives
The incidence of waterborne and foodborne infectious diseases (WFIDs) continues to increase annually, attracting significant global attention. This study examined trends in WFID outbreaks in the Republic of Korea over the 5-year period before and during the coronavirus disease 2019 (COVID-19) pandemic and provided foundational data to establish measures for the prevention and control of WFID outbreaks. Methods: We analyzed 2,541 WFID outbreaks from 2017 to 2021 (42,805 cases) that were reported through the Integrated Disease Surveillance System of the Korea Disease Control and Prevention Agency. Outbreaks were defined as the occurrence of gastrointestinal symptoms in ≥2 individuals within a group with temporal and regional epidemiological associations. The related factors associated with WFID outbreaks during the observation period were statistically analyzed. Results: The total number of WFID outbreaks significantly decreased in 2020 during the COVID-19 pandemic and increased to the pre-pandemic level in 2021. Different patterns were observed for each pathogen. The incidence of Salmonella outbreaks more than doubled, while norovirus outbreaks decreased significantly. Conclusion: WFID outbreaks in the Republic of Korea showed different patterns before and during the COVID-19 pandemic, influenced by infection control measures and changes in dietary consumption patterns. Outbreaks of some diseases increased, but the infection control measures applied during the pandemic resulted in a significant decrease in the overall number of WFID outbreaks. This highlights the importance of strengthening the management strategies for outbreak prevention through hygiene inspections, long-term monitoring, education, and promotion by conducting multidimensional analyses to understand the complex related factors.

Objectives
Several previous studies have stated that consuming certain foods and beverages might increase the risk of chronic kidney disease (CKD). This study aimed to examine the relationships of food and beverage consumption with other risk factors for CKD. Methods: Data sources included the 2018 Basic Health Research (Riskesdas) and the National Socio-Economic Survey (Susenas), which were analyzed using a cross-sectional design. The study samples were households from 34 provinces in Indonesia, and the analysis was performed with provincial aggregates. Data were analyzed using risk factor analysis followed by linear regression to identify relationships with CKD. Results: The prevalence of CKD in Indonesia was 0.38%. The province with the highest prevalence was North Kalimantan (0.64%), while the lowest was found in West Sulawesi (0.18%). Five major groups were formed from 15 identified risk factors using factor analysis. A linear regression model presented 1 significant selected factor (p=0.006, R2 =31%). The final model of risk factors included water quality, consumption of fatty foods, and a history of diabetes. Conclusion: Drinking water quality, fatty food consumption, and diabetes are associated with CKD. There is a need to monitor drinking water, as well as to promote health education and provide comprehensive services for people with diabetes, to prevent CKD.

Objectives
This study analyzed trends in foodborne and waterborne diseases in South Korea between 2015 and 2019.
Methods
The data consisted of information on outbreaks of waterborne and foodborne infectious diseases reported through the Korea Centers for Disease Control and Prevention (KCDC) system. We analyzed the trends and epidemiological aspects of outbreaks by month, place of occurrence, and causative pathogens in this observational study.
Results
The number of outbreaks has steadily increased over the last 5 years, but the number of cases per outbreak has followed a decreasing trend. Incidence at daycare centers and preschools has been steadily increasing over consecutive years.
Conclusion
The steady number of patients and decreasing number of cases per outbreak, even as the number of outbreaks has been increasing, suggest that the KCDC’s professional management system is operating effectively. It is necessary to continue improving the objectivity and efficiency of the management system and to carefully examine the increasing number of outbreaks in smaller-scale group catering facilities, such as daycare centers and preschools. Outbreaks can be prevented by closely examining those caused by unidentified pathogens and group outbreaks caused by other diseases, identifying problems, and supplementing the management system.

Objectives

It was supposed to analyze status and affecting factors in water and food-borne communicable disease by screening entrants with diarrhea symptom at the point of entry in Korea

Methods

Symptomatic travelers with water and food-borne communicable diseases who entered Korea were diagnosed by a health declaration and detection of causative agents in water and food using laboratory tests. Among those entered in 2017, the affecting factors in the incidence of communicable diseases among those who had diarrhea at the entry into Korea, were analyzed, with frequency and chi-square test.

Results

The number of travel entrants with gastrointestinal communicable diseases increased by 40.19% from 2013 to 2017. The percentage of causative agents of water and food-borne communicable diseases was the highest at 69.2% from July to September. The rate of detection of causative agents of communicable disease pathogens in travelers from Southeast Asia entering Korea was 70.2%, which was higher than people arriving from East Asia and Central Asia (57.5%; p < 0.001).

Conclusion

The positive ratio of causative agents of water and food-borne communicable diseases was high among travelers that had entered Korea from July to September, with a high number among entrants from Southeast Asia. Based on the positive detection of causative agents, the entry period and countries visited were statistically significant affecting factors (p < 0.001).

Objectives

Investigations into foodborne illness, potentially caused by Kudoa septempunctata, has been ongoing in Korea since 2015. However, epidemiological analysis reporting and positive K septempunctata detection in feces in Korea has been limited. The aim of this study was to provide epidemiologic data analysis of possible food poisoning caused by K septempunctata in Korea.

Methods

This study reviewed 16 Kudoa outbreak investigation reports, including suspected cases between 2015 and 2016 in Gyeonggi province, Korea. Suspected Kudoa foodborne illness outbreak was defined as “evidence of K septempunctata in at least one sample.” The time and place of outbreak, patient symptoms and Kudoa (+) detection rate in feces was analyzed.

Results

Kudoa foodborne illness outbreaks occurred in most patients in August (22.6%) and in most outbreaks in April (25%). The attack rate was 53.9% and the average attack rate in patients who had consumed olive flounder was 64.7%. The average incubation period was 4.3 hours per outbreak. Diarrhea was the most common symptom which was reported by 91.5% patients. The Kudoa (+) detection rate in feces was 69.2% of cases.

Conclusion

Monthly distribution of Kudoa foodborne illness was different from previous studies. The Kudoa (+) detection rate in feces decreased rapidly between 25.5 and 28.5 hours of the time interval from food intake to epidemiologic survey. To identify effective period of time of investigation, we believe additional study with extended number of cases is necessary.

Objectives

The objective of this review is to propose an appropriate course of action for improving the guidelines followed by food handlers for control of infection. For this purpose, previous epidemiological reports related to acute gastroenteritis in food service businesses mediated by food handlers were intensively analyzed.

Methods

Relevant studies were identified in international databases. We selected eligible papers reporting foodborne infectious disease outbreaks. Among primary literature collection, the abstract of each article was investigated to find cases that absolutely identified a causative factor to be food handlers’ inappropriate infection control and the taxon of causative microbial agents by epidemiological methodologies. Information about the sites (type of food business) where the outbreaks occurred was investigated.

Results

A wide variety of causative microbial agents has been investigated, using several epidemiological methods. These agents have shown diverse propagation pathways based on their own molecular pathogenesis, physiology, taxonomy, and etiology.

Conclusion

Depending on etiology, transmission, propagation, and microbiological traits, we can predict the transmission characteristics of pathogens in food preparation areas. The infected food workers have a somewhat different ecological place in infection epidemiology as compared to the general population. However, the current Korean Food Safety Act cannot propose detailed guidelines. Therefore, different methodologies have to be made available to prevent further infections.

Objectives
The purpose of this study was to develop an educational model regarding food safety and nutrition. In particular, we aimed to develop educational materials, such as middle- and high-school textbooks, a teacher’s guidebook, and school posters, by applying social cognitive theory.
Methods
To develop a food safety and nutrition education program, we took into account diverse factors influencing an individual’s behavior, such as personal, behavioral, and environmental factors, based on social cognitive theory. We also conducted a pilot study of the educational materials targeting middle-school students (n = 26), high-school students (n = 24), and dietitians (n = 13) regarding comprehension level, content, design, and quality by employing the 5-point Likert scale in May 2016.
Results
The food safety and nutrition education program covered six themes: (1) caffeine; (2) food additives; (3) foodborne illness; (4) nutrition and meal planning; (5) obesity and eating disorders; and (6) nutrition labeling. Each class activity was created to improve self-efficacy by setting one’s own goal and to increase self-control by monitoring one’s dietary intake. We also considered environmental factors by creating school posters and leaflets to educate teachers and parents. The overall evaluation score for the textbook was 4.0 points among middle- and high-school students, and 4.5 points among dietitians.
Conclusion
This study provides a useful program model that could serve as a guide to develop educational materials for nutrition-related subjects in the curriculum. This program model was created to increase awareness of nutrition problems and self-efficacy. This program also helped to improve nutrition management skills and to promote a healthy eating environment in middle- and high-school students.

Objectives
Food- and water-borne disease outbreaks (FBDOs) are an important public health problem worldwide. This study investigated the trends in FBDOs in Korea and established emerging causal pathogens and causal vehicles.
Methods
We analyzed FBDOs in Korea by year, location, causal pathogens, and causal vehicles from 2007 to 2012. Information was collected from the FBDOs database in the Korean Centers for Disease Control and Prevention.
Results
During 2007–2012, a total of 1794 FBDOs and 48,897 patients were reported. After 2007, FBDOs and patient numbers steadily decreased over the next 2 years and then plateaued until 2011. However, in 2012, FBDOs increased slightly accompanied by a large increase in the number of affected patients. Our results highlight the emergence of norovirus and pathogenic Escherichia coli other than enterohemorrhagic E. coli (EHEC) in schools in 2012. We found that pickled vegetables is an emerging causal vehicle responsible for this problem.
Conclusion
On the basis of this study we recommend intensified inspections of pickled vegetable manufacturers and the strengthening of laboratory surveillance of relevant pathogens.

Objectives
The present study investigated associations between income and intake of nutrients and food in adults (n = 11,063) from the fourth Korea National Health and Nutrition Examination Survey 2007–2009.
Methods
To examine relationships between individual dietary intake and anthropometric measures and family income, multiple linear regression models were constructed for each outcome variable. All models were adjusted for age, education, energy intake, smoking, body mass index, and physical activity.
Results
For men, intakes of protein, calcium, phosphorus, potassium, and vitamin C were lower in low-income compared to high-income groups. For women, intakes of protein and niacin were lower in low-income groups. Lowest income group ate less dairy products in men and less fruits and fishes or shellfishes in women.
Conclusion
Low-income groups had severe food insecurity and low diet quality compared to high-income groups. The study results will provide direction for public health efforts regarding dietary intakes according to economic status among Korean men and women.

Objectives
In Korea, every outbreak of acute gastroenteritis in two or more patients who are epidemiologically related is investigated by local public health centres to determine causative agents and control the outbreak with the support of the Korean Centers for Disease Control and Prevention. The findings and conclusions of each outbreak investigation have been summarized annually since 2007 to make reports and statistics of water- and foodborne disease outbreaks.
Methods
All outbreaks reported to Korean Centers for Disease Control and Prevention from 2007 to 2009 were included in the study. We analysed the trends and epidemiologic aspects of outbreaks by month, year, and location.
Results
The total number of outbreaks decreased steadily each year for the period the study covered, whereas the number of patients per outbreak continued to increase resulting from a dramatic increase in the number of patients per outbreak in food service establishments. The outbreaks occurred in the period of June to September, when temperature and humidity are relatively high, which accounted for 44.3% of total outbreaks. The monthly number of outbreaks decreased steadily until November after peaking in May 2009. The most common causative agent was norovirus (16.5%) followed by pathogenic Escherichia coli. The rate of causative agent identification was 60.1%, with higher identification rates in larger outbreaks.
Conclusions
Although a decreasing trend of outbreaks by year was observed in the study, the food services in schools and companies require more attention to hygiene and sanitation to prevent large outbreaks. The ability to establish the cause of an outbreak should be further improved.

Global warming has various effects on human health. The main indirect effects are on infectious diseases. Although the effects on infectious diseases will be detected worldwide, the degree and types of the effect are different, depending on the location of the respective countries and socioeconomical situations.Among infectious diseases, water- and foodborne infectious diseases and vector-borne infectious diseases are two main categories that are forecasted to be most affected. The effect on vector-borne infectious diseases such as malaria and dengue fever is mainly because of the expansion of the infested areas of vector mosquitoes and increase in the number and feeding activity of infected mosquitoes. There will be increase in the number of cases with water- and foodborne diarrhoeal diseases.Even with the strongest mitigation procedures, global warming cannot be avoided for decades. Therefore, implementation of adaptation measures to the effect of global warming is the most practical action we can take. It is generally accepted that the impacts of global warming on infectious diseases have not been apparent at this point yet in East Asia. However, these impacts will appear in one form or another if global warming continues to progress in future. Further research on the impacts of global warming on infectious diseases and on future prospects should be conducted.
